Azzurri go Greek

The Italian National team will take on Greece tonight in a friendly game which allows each coach to experiment some more with potential line-ups and combinations while allowing new players debuts.

It is an Azzurri side that has been hit with a few injuries, as Andrea Pirlo is still out following his right thigh injury several months back while Aquilani is only starting to make progress with his injury. Gianluca Zambrotta also had to miss the game due to a knock picked up in the warm up on the weekend. And to add to the injury list Buffon will be out until next year following his back problem.

The injuries however have allowed Lippi to make up a few surprise call-ups which could result in international debuts for the new comers. The tactician chose to opt for Udinese's Geatano D'Agostino due to injury to teammate Toto Di Natale.


In an ironic twist compared to the World Cup there will be several Italian Internationals that play abroad playing for the Azzurri tonight. De Scantis is expected to be handed his first start for the Azzurri while Grosso, Cannavaro, Dossena return in defence alongside Toni and Rossi in attack.

It is an injury stricken team that still boasts a lot of potential but playing in Greece is never an easy challenge and the 2002 Euro Winners will be looking to take control against the World Cup winners.
